Abstract

The utility model discloses a retrieval type safety protection power supply circuit, including resistance R1, unidirectional thyristor Q1, relay K and triode V5, resistance R1's one end connecting resistance R3, triode V2's projecting pole, triode V3's collecting electrode, triode V4's collecting electrode, triode V5's collecting electrode, lamps and lanterns H and power E's positive pole, diode D1's positive pole and triode V1's collecting electrode are connected to resistance R1's the other end, and potentiometre RP1's a stiff end is connected to triode V1's projecting pole. The utility model discloses retrieval type safety protection power supply circuit simple structure, components and parts are few, not only can provide the DC voltage for the load to still having overload protection and short -circuit protection's function, utilizing the relay to form the electromagnetism protection circuit simultaneously, increase the reaction sensitivity of circuit, effective protection circuit is not damaged, has consequently that the function is various, the protection is effectual and convenient to use's advantage.

Operation principle of the present utility model is: reference voltage power supply flows through the electric current of Zener diode D2 to be stablized by light fixture H, thus improves degree of stability, and overload instruction is the most also used as by light fixture.By adjusting potentiometer RP2, the output voltage of manostat can conveniently regulate, and load maximum current and can be determined by regulator potentiometer RP1.Circuit have employed Electronic Protection and two kinds of measures of electromagnetic protection, and electronic protection circuit is made up of audion V1 and unidirectional thyristor Q1 etc..When overload or short circuit, the pressure drop on detection resistance R0 increases, and audion V1 and IGCT Q1 is toggled and turns on.The reference voltage power supply due to its short circuit, therefore audion V3, V4 cut-off, audion V5 base stage no-bias and end, reach the purpose of overcurrent protection.
After overload or short trouble eliminate, to power up to original state, only SR S1 need to be pressed.Because after button press, the short circuit of IGCT Q1 anode one negative electrode, and control pole no-bias, therefore IGCT Q1 cut-off.
The electronic lock being made up of audion V1 is introduced in manostat; its objective is to reduce the output impedance of manostat; use the additional electromagnetic protection circuit being made up of audion V2 and relay K; when manostat has worked long hours in the case of maximum current value, if there is no electromagnetic protection, when load is slightly transshipped; although Electronic Protection action; but audion V5 is not completely switched off, big electric current continues through it, it is likely that burnt.Having had electromagnetic protection, when load slightly overload or short circuit, it just can action rapidly.I.e. when IGCT Q1 turns on, audion V2 base stage is added to the positive ends of Zener diode through resistance R2, and V2 turns on, relay K adhesive, and its normally opened contact K-1 connects not moved end 2, and the base stage of audion V5 is connected on positive ends, and V5 ends, and cuts off load A loop.
